Pursuant to subdivision (g) of Section 8879.23, an eligible project funded pursuant to this article shall require a match of one dollar ($1) of eligible local matching funds for each dollar of program funds applied for under this article. An applicant may propose to use other funds for the same project, including local, federal, or other state funds, however, those other funds shall not be counted toward the match required by this article.
